Aldofashow Posted March 12, 2016 Report Share Posted March 12, 2016 There are a couple different steering boxes that were used as they said the top where your steering wheel shaft hooks up has a cover there's a 3 bolt and a 4 bolt cover mine had a 4 bolt cover so that's what they sent me I asked what pitman arm to order they said 4 spline I'm thinking mine must've come with a 4 spline but I won't know for sure till I pull it out I'll let you know I'm not 100% sure what's different between the 2 boxes but the Redhead boxes are suppose to be really nice replacements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
